Got PC version of Twin Mirror when I get to Dennis dead in the office I go to the Computer but it never gives me action buttons to access it. IS there a fix? am I missing something?

I can select to get on the screen but unable to open the email or anything there are no options to use the PC once I am in the screen.
I notice other players on Youtube get option on bottom left press B or A to access or read email I get nothing at all completely unable to access the email or even back out of using PC. Have to Cntrl+Alt+Del to shut game down or go to main menu.
